WebAs temperature increases, the vapor pressure of a liquid also increases due to the increased average KE of its molecules. Recall that at any given temperature the molecules of a substance experience a range of kinetic energies with a certain fraction of molecules having a sufficient energy to overcome IMF and escape the liquid (vaporize).
